Juicy Beaches!

juicy-couture-islands.jpgIt’s coming up to beach season, and Juicy is getting in on it with this funky purse from the Spring collection.

It’s called the Juicy Couture Islands Bag, a clear plastic purse with leather trim. It is perfect for use anywhere there will be water, with a gorgeous Juicy Couture Map-Print towel inside and the Couture print on the front.

And you thought going to the beach couldn’t get any more fun!

SRP $165.00

But Of Kors!

michael-kors-skorpios.jpgThis gorgeous summery bag is called the Skorpios purse, from Michael Kors.

Made of a deliciously soft creamy white leather, the Skorpios can be dressed up or down depending on your entire look.

With gold hardware, a woven leather strap and magnetic closure, its a classy, beautiful purse that will last you through the sunshine weather!

SRP $795.00

Bowling With Jacobs

marc-jacobs-king-pin.jpgThis is just about the cutest bowling bag you can get at the moment – the King Pin Strike bag, by Marc Jacobs.

Made of a lovely grained leather with rolled handles and textile lining, this sexy little purse is perfect for daytime use and adds a hip, edgy touch to almost any outfit.

The retro, funky canvas panels on the front of the bag are a perfect touch and make this one of the most adorable new-season purses around.

So go bowl!

SRP $368.00

Ferrrrrrrrrragamo!

salvatore-ferragamo-continental.jpgThis highly unique wallet is the Fiera Continental from Salvatore Ferragamo, a colorful, eye-catching little purse and one of the highlights of Ferragamo’s new season collection.
Made of black fabric with leather trim and silver hardware, the resplendent jungle-animal print is delightfully 1960′s Italian couture – and that tiger really is a deliciously retro touch.

Like all Ferragamo purses, it is beautifully made and will last for as long as you need it to!

SRP $390.00
